Sumter Today: South Carolina is moving into Phase 1b of its vaccination rollout

Posted

With the announcement from the state yesterday that South Carolina is moving into Phase 1b of its vaccination rollout, teachers, other frontline essential workers, those with high-risk health conditions and anyone aged 55 or older can start making appointments on Monday, March 8.

However, a special exemption was given to a mass vaccination clinic being held on the Darlington Raceway this Friday for anyone eligible in Phase 1A or Phase 1B.
McLeod Health is partnering with the raceway to hold the event, and more information on it can be found at our webpage dedicated to coronavirus coverage at TheItem.com/coronavirus.
